Transaction a84c9837e43613d5521cd85526359dba3215d5607620e84971c99b38cf5ae15d

1 Input
2 Outputs
  • a84c9837e43613d5521cd85526359dba3215d5607620e84971c99b38cf5ae15d:0
  • value  1521901
    address  3JJrEhm1wiQ5KnXbPfg3ae9CLHC8CLw7mj
  • a84c9837e43613d5521cd85526359dba3215d5607620e84971c99b38cf5ae15d:1
  • value  132116587
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D